Arthroscopic Shavers
Challenge: To grind two mating metal components, with a tight clearance requirement between their surfaces, to create a powered arthroscopic shaver used in orthopaedic joint surgeries. Solution: In this application, two tubes are assembled, with as minimum a gap between the two parts as possible -sometimes as small as 0.0005” -so that the inner tube moves freely inside the outer tube without allowing debris to get caught between the surfaces.
